The federal government is responsible for enforcement of immigration laws.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E), a government agency formed in 2003, enforces federal law governing immigration and related issues. For example, if an immigrant violates immigration law, he or she is subject to apprehension, prosecution, and possible deportation by ICE. The federal government dedicates substantial resources to immigration enforcement through ICE. Yet, local and state authorities are attempting to implement immigration laws and policies to address immigration enforcement at the local and state level.
